svn commit: r344125 - head/audio/id3mtag

Emanuel Haupt ehaupt at FreeBSD.org
Thu Feb 13 14:56:05 UTC 2014


Author: ehaupt
Date: Thu Feb 13 14:56:04 2014
New Revision: 344125
URL: http://svnweb.freebsd.org/changeset/ports/344125
QAT: https://qat.redports.org/buildarchive/r344125/

Log:
  - Support staging
  - Add LICENSE

Modified:
  head/audio/id3mtag/Makefile

Modified: head/audio/id3mtag/Makefile
==============================================================================
--- head/audio/id3mtag/Makefile	Thu Feb 13 14:54:31 2014	(r344124)
+++ head/audio/id3mtag/Makefile	Thu Feb 13 14:56:04 2014	(r344125)
@@ -10,30 +10,25 @@ DISTNAME=	id3-${PORTVERSION}
 MAINTAINER=	squell at alumina.nl
 COMMENT=	Mass tagging utility for audio files
 
-MAN1=		id3.1
-PLIST_FILES=	bin/id3
+LICENSE=	BSD2CLAUSE
 
 MAKEFILE=	makefile
-NO_STAGE=	yes
 ALL_TARGET=	build
 MAKE_ARGS=	CC="${CC}" CFLAGS="${CFLAGS}" \
 		CXX="${CXX}" CXXFLAGS="${CXXFLAGS}"
 
-PORTDOCS=	*
+PLIST_FILES=	bin/id3 man/man1/id3.1.gz
+PORTDOCS=	README CHANGES
 
-OPTIONS_DEFINE=	DOCS 
-
-.include <bsd.port.options.mk>
+OPTIONS_DEFINE=	DOCS
 
 do-install:
-	${MKDIR} ${PREFIX}/bin ${MANPREFIX}/man/man1
-	${INSTALL_PROGRAM} ${WRKSRC}/id3 ${PREFIX}/bin
-	${INSTALL_MAN} ${WRKSRC}/id3.man ${MANPREFIX}/man/man1/id3.1
-.if ${PORT_OPTIONS:MDOCS}
-		${MKDIR} ${DOCSDIR}
-		${INSTALL_DATA} ${WRKSRC}/README  ${DOCSDIR}
-		${INSTALL_DATA} ${WRKSRC}/CHANGES ${DOCSDIR}
-		${INSTALL_DATA} ${WRKSRC}/COPYING ${DOCSDIR}
-.	endif
+	${MKDIR} ${PREFIX}/bin ${STAGEDIR}${MANPREFIX}/man/man1
+	${INSTALL_PROGRAM} ${WRKSRC}/id3 ${STAGEDIR}${PREFIX}/bin
+	${INSTALL_MAN} ${WRKSRC}/id3.man ${STAGEDIR}${MANPREFIX}/man/man1/id3.1
+	${MKDIR} ${STAGEDIR}${DOCSDIR}
+.for f in ${PORTDOCS}
+	${INSTALL_DATA} ${WRKSRC}/${f} ${STAGEDIR}${DOCSDIR}
+.endfor
 
 .include <bsd.port.mk>


More information about the svn-ports-all mailing list